May Retail Sales Data Overview

Retail sales in May fell short of forecasts, signaling a potential weakening in consumer activity.

Analysis by Wells Fargo

The analysis conducted by Wells Fargo emphasizes the importance of monitoring consumer spending trends as an indicator of economic health.

  • Consumer Momentum: The decline in retail sales suggests a loss of momentum in consumer activity.
  • Economic Indicator: Retail sales data is crucial for assessing the overall economic performance.
  1. Conclusion: The diminished retail sales figures raise concerns about the sustainability of consumer-driven economic growth.
